在Git diff工具中,可以使用--ignore-all-space
或-w
参数来忽略空白差异。这样可以使得Git diff工具在比较代码时忽略空格、制表符等空白字符的差异,从而更加方便地查看代码变动。
具体使用方法是在git diff
命令后面加上--ignore-all-space
或-w
参数,例如:
git diff --ignore-all-space
或者
git diff -w
其中,--ignore-all-space
和-w
的作用是相同的,都是忽略空白差异。如果想要忽略空格差异,可以使用--ignore-space-change
或-b
参数;如果想要忽略行尾空格差异,可以使用--ignore-space-at-eol
或-Z
参数。
除了在命令行中使用参数外,也可以在.gitconfig
文件中设置默认参数,以便在以后的使用中无需每次都手动输入参数。具体方法是在.gitconfig
文件中加入以下配置:
[diff]
ignoreallspace = true
这样,以后在使用git diff
命令时,就会默认忽略空白差异。